Skating club has strong start

The Cochrane Skating Club is celebrating the success of its the first competition of the season.

Fifteen members – three juniors, five intermediates and seven seniors – participated in the Edmonton Region Open hosted by the Derrick Skating Club from Dec. 2 to 4.

Several athletes brought home medals for their performances.

The Cochrane club just completed its fall programming and is moving into the heart of the season, with a few new offerings for those who love to be on the ice.

Families of younger children and home-schooled kids, who are often available earlier in the day, can now take part in Daytime Pre-CanSkate and CanSkate programs, and older youth who haven’t yet had an opportunity to learn to skate sign up for the new TeenCanSkate session.
